`textFit` - Hassle-Free Text Fitting

==================================



A **fast**, dependency-free text sizing component that quickly fits single and multi-line text to the width and/or height of its container.



[Example](http://textfit.strml.net/examples/textFit.html)



Capabilities

============



`textFit` is:



* Fast, using binary search to quickly fit text to its container in `log n` time, making it far faster than most solutions.
* Most fits are `<1ms`. See the [implementation details](#implementation-details).

* Most fits are `<1ms`. See the [implementation details](#implementation-details).

* Dependency-free.

* Small. `4.1KB` minified and `1.5KB` gzipped.

* Supports both horizontal and vertical centering, including vertical centering with Flexbox for maximum accuracy.

* Supports any font face, padding, and multiline text.

Usage
=====



```html
<div class="box" style="width:300px;height:300px">
Fit me, I am some text

<div class="box" style="width:300px;height:300px">

Fit me, I am some text

</div>

```



```javascript

// textFit accepts arrays

textFit(document.getElementsByClassName('box'));

// or single DOM elements

textFit(document.getElementsByClassName('box')[0]);

// Use jQuery selectors if you like.

textFit($('#box')[0])

```



The text will scale until it reaches the horizontal or vertical bounds of the box.

Explicit width and height styles are required in order to fit the text.

Implementation Details
----------------------

textFit determines reasonable minimum and maximum bounds for your text. The defaults are listed below.



To ensure accurate results with various font-faces, line-heights, and letter-spacings, textFit resizes the text

until it fits the box as accurately as possible. Unlike many similar plugins, textFit uses **binary search** to

find the correct fit, which speeds the process significantly. textFit is fast enough to use in production

websites.



`textFit()` is a synchronous function. Because of this, resizes should be invisible as the render thread does not

have a chance to do a layout until completion. Normal processing times should be < 1ms and should not significantly

block renders.
